Enjoy a guided historical walking tour of Creek Street and the Fishing Fleet, book ended by drinks at the Fishermen's favorite watering holes. Learn about the colorful events that have shaped Ketchikan, The Salmon Capitol of the World and Alaska's First City. After a round at the "Shipwreck Bar", we'll stroll through town to Creek Street then down to the docks to learn about the world famous fishing fleet and see the boats and crews up close preparing for their next catch. We'll finish at the infamous Potlatch Bar for more drinks and stories.

You will be guided by a Fisherman who lives on the Fishing Fleet’s Dock in Ketchikan. Your guide has first hand knowledge of the Fishing Fleet and their favorite watering holes. Fun, entertainment, drinks, history and a few tall tales make this a “must do” tour while visiting Ketchikan!
